- Summary:
- Discover the secret to making a memorable overall impression in an interview by leaving a series of microimpressions.
- A successful interview isn't just about making an impression, but rather about making a series of the right impressions-consciously or subconsciously-at a micro level. It may sound overwhelming, but you can make all of the right impressions as a candidate if you plan for it as part of your overall interview preparation strategy. Unlock the secret to entering an interview without feeling burdened by a checklist of required first impressions. Gather insights from instructor Scott Mautz on altering and supplementing your interview prep to ensure the impressions you want to make are made naturally. As you progress through the course, Scott offers wisdom drawn from over ten years of professional experience leading a high-producing recruiting team to help you set the stage for interview success.
